Are there any residential inpatient rehab centers located directly in Greensburg, KS, or will I need to travel to a nearby city?
Greensburg itself is a small rural community and does not host a residential inpatient facility. For 24/7 medically supervised care, residents typically travel to larger regional hubs like Wichita, Pratt, or Dodge City, which are within a 1-2 hour drive. Local resources in Greensburg, such as Kiowa County Memorial Hospital and counseling services, can provide referrals and support for arranging treatment at these nearby centers.
How can I verify if a rehab center in the Greensburg, KS area accepts my Kansas Medicaid (KanCare) or private insurance?
The most reliable method is to contact the Kansas Department for Aging and Disability Services (KDADS) or use the KanCare provider directory online to find approved facilities near Greensburg. You can also call the admissions department of any specific center in the region (e.g., in Pratt or Wichita) directly; they can verify your KanCare plan or private insurance coverage and explain any co-pays or out-of-pocket costs relevant to Kansas residents.

For a family in Greensburg, KS, dealing with a teen's substance use, what are the nearest specialized adolescent treatment options?
Specialized adolescent programs are not available in Greensburg itself. Families should seek services in larger cities like Wichita, which has facilities such as the Via Christi Recovery Center or behavioral health hospitals offering teen-specific programs. The Greensburg USD 422 school counselor or a local pediatrician at Kiowa County Memorial Hospital can provide initial assessments and referrals to these regional adolescent treatment centers.
If I need immediate help for a substance use crisis in Greensburg, KS, where should I go before entering a formal rehab program?
For immediate medical or psychiatric crises, go to the Kiowa County Memorial Hospital Emergency Department in Greensburg. They can provide stabilization, conduct assessments, and connect you with crisis hotlines like the Kansas Crisis Hotline (1-866-427-4747). They can also facilitate referrals to detox or inpatient facilities in the region, such as those in Pratt or Wichita, for continued treatment.
